Download conviértete en desarrollador blockchain con ethereum

La guía completa de desarrollo de Ethereum con Solidity y JavaScript

4.37 (1244 valoraciones) / 3846 estudiantes inscritos
Creado por Carlos Landeras
Fecha de la última actualización: 2021-01-10

Descripción

Blockchain es una tecnología revolucionaria que va a cambiar el futuro y para muchos va a tener el mismo impacto que la propia aparición de internet en los años 90. Cada vez más empresas y entidades centran su atención en el desarrollo de Smart Contracts para poder crear aplicaciones descentralizadas y distribuidas y actualmente se requiere un gran número de profesionales en el sector, siendo una gran oportunidad formarse en esta tecnología.

En este curso, comenzaremos con una introducción teórica sobre que es Blockchain y mas concretamente, profundizaremos en la plataforma Ethereum y una vez entendamos cuales son las principales características de esta plataforma, nos sumergiremos en un amplio viaje para convertirnos en desarrolladores Ethereum.

Comenzaremos nuestra andadura desde cero, dando los primeros pasos con el lenguaje Solidity, aprenderemos a compilar y a desplegar Smart Contracts en distintos entornos y a verificar la calidad de nuestros contractos mediante el desarrollo de tests de integración.

Según vayamos adquiriendo más conocimientos, iremos creando Smart Contracts mas complejos, adquiriendo nuevas habilidades con el lenguaje de Solidity y obtendremos una amplia experiencia utilizando herramientas habituales del ecosistema Ethereum como web3, truffle, solc, metamask, hdwallet y ganache.


Para afianzar los conocimientos al final del curso, crearemos una página web completa utilizando JavasScript y  framework React.js, para que nuestros usuarios puedan utilizar nuestra aplicación descentralizada alojada en la red Ethereum a través de una interfaz sencilla e intuitiva, donde podrán firmar sus transacciones y sentirse cómodos interactuando con una aplicación desplegada en Blockchain.

en

Download conviértete en desarrollador blockchain con ethereum

Download conviértete en desarrollador blockchain con ethereum

Los estudiantes también compraron

Información sobre el Instructor

Download conviértete en desarrollador blockchain con ethereum

  • 4.37 Calificación

  • 3846 Estudiantes

  • 1 Cursos

Carlos Landeras

Senior Software Developer

Carlos Landeras es un desarrollador de software con mas de diez años de experiencia principalmente enfocado al desarrollo web y Blockchain.

Tiene pasión por enseñar y trasmitir conocimiento por eso es habitual verle participando en conferencias y meetups y ahora ha decidido continuar con la enseñanza en Udemy.

Microsoft, le ha otorgado el premio MVP en la categoría Developer Technologies por sus contribuciones al código libre y sus aportaciones técnicas.

Comentarios de los estudiantes

4.37

Valoración del curso

Reseñas

en

Download conviértete en desarrollador blockchain con ethereum

Download conviértete en desarrollador blockchain con ethereum

- Introducción a Blockchain y Ethereum
- Comenzando a desarrollar Smart Contracts
- Profundizando con Solidity
- Balance y transferencias en Smart Contracts
- Ampliando conocimientos de solidity con un nuevo Smart Contract
- Compilando y desplegando smart contracts con Solc y Web3.js
- Truffle.js y Web3
- Desarrollando una aplicación completa - La aerolínea
- Tests de integración del smart contract con truffle
- Metamask y Mnemonic
- Iniciando la web de nuestra aplicación descentralizada - La aerolínea
- Interactuando con Metamask para firmar transacciones
- Completando todas las funcionalidades de la web
- Eventos de Ethereum en la web
- Desplegando nuestro Smart Contract en la red pública de Ethereum

Download conviértete en desarrollador blockchain con ethereum

Senior Software Developer Consultant - Speaker - WordPress Enthusiast

- Introducción a Blockchain y Ethereum
- Comenzando a desarrollar Smart Contracts
- Profundizando con Solidity
- Balance y transferencias en Smart Contracts
- Ampliando conocimientos de solidity con un nuevo Smart Contract
- Compilando y desplegando smart contracts con Solc y Web3.js
- Truffle.js y Web3
- Desarrollando una aplicación completa - La aerolínea
- Tests de integración del smart contract con truffle
- Metamask y Mnemonic
- Iniciando la web de nuestra aplicación descentralizada - La aerolínea
- Interactuando con Metamask para firmar transacciones
- Completando todas las funcionalidades de la web
- Eventos de Ethereum en la web
- Desplegando nuestro Smart Contract en la red pública de Ethereum

¿Qué puedo desarrollar en el blockchain de Ethereum?

Aspectos esenciales.
Cuentas. Contratos o personas en la red..
Transacciones. Cómo cambia el estado de Ethereum..
Bloques. Lotes de transacciones añadidas a la cadena de bloques..
La máquina virtual de Ethereum (EVM) El ordenador que procesa transacciones..
Gas. ... .
Nodos y clientes. ... .
Redes. ... .
Minería..

¿Cuánto cobra un desarrollador blockchain en España?

El salario medio de un desarrollador Blockchain se sitúa entre los 30.000 y los 60.000 euros anuales. Los sueldos más bajos corresponden a técnicos que cuentan con una menor responsabilidad y experiencia. Los consultores con experiencia pueden percibir un sueldo que ronda de media los 40.000 euros.

¿Cómo convertirse en desarrollador blockchain?

Resumen.
Aprender lo básico de la tecnología blockchain y criptomonedas. ... .
Compra algo de criptomonedas. ... .
Prueba aprender los fundamentos de la programación blockchain con Space Doggos o CryptoZombies. ... .
Inscríbete en un curso más avanzado de Solidity, como el que se ofrece aquí en BitDegree..
¡Ponte a programar!.

¿Qué es un desarrollador de blockchain?

Los desarrolladores de blockchain ayudan a crear y mantener bases de datos digitales descentralizadas, o blockchain, para almacenar y compartir información, de forma segura, transparente y sin intermediarios.